* azuremonitor: add gzipped and base64 encoded query to metadata
for Azure Log Analytic query responses
* azure monitor: add fields to metadata for log analytics
* azuremonitor: correction to text in query editor
* azuremonitor: adds subscription id to result metadata
* azuremonitor: build deep link url for Log Analytics
Most of the information needed for building the url
comes from the backend. The workspace friendly name
and the resource group that the workspace belongs
to are fetched in a separate API call. This call is
cached otherwise there would be a workspaces call
per query on the dashboard.

* feat: AzureMonitor config page with multiple subs
Adds support for multiple subscriptions for the different
variations of configuring Azure Monitor and Azure Logs.
To be able to show a list of subscriptions, the config
has to be saved first - the plugin route fetches the
tenant id, client id and client secret from the database
so a call to get subscriptions requires that those
fields are saved first. If the page has not saved then
the use can manually paste in a subscription id.
